What was the major event associated with the assassination of President Abraham Lincoln? 🔊
The major event associated with the assassination of President Abraham Lincoln is his murder on April 14, 1865, by John Wilkes Booth. Lincoln was shot while attending a play at Ford's Theatre in Washington, D.C. His assassination occurred just days after the Confederacy surrendered, marking the end of the American Civil War. This act was motivated by Booth's beliefs that Lincoln was destroying the South and undermining the Confederate cause. Lincoln's death had profound implications for the Reconstruction era and the future of the nation, resulting in a power struggle and significant changes in policy.
